Restaurant Summary

A tiny room in Don Bosco hums with warm hospitality and lantern glow while bowls of steaming broth and glossy braises parade from a compact kitchen. Guests describe service that feels personal—"they walked us through the menu and adjusted spice"—and an atmosphere that reads cozy and intimate rather than crowded. Expect fresh-cooked dishes and a pace that favors care over speed, with a neighborhood vibe far from tourist routes. The cooking leans authentic Northeast Chinese more than pan-Asian crowd-pleasers: Dongpo pork that melts without greasiness, plum-braised ribs, Ma La Tang, and beef in fragrant broths. Flavors are clean, often bold, and not reliant on frying—great for diners chasing regional character, less so for those craving spring rolls. Portions trend generous in big bowls, though a few guests wished for more solids versus broth; overall, it is comforting and distinctive. For families, there is enough for cautious eaters—plain rice, mild broths, braised pork—yet spice, offal, and assertive seasonings feature prominently. No dedicated kids menu is noted. If your crew enjoys adventure, this works; if not, plan on simpler picks and ask for reduced heat.
